Marchi","doi":"10.1109/MetroAutomotive57488.2023.10219099","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/MetroAutomotive57488.2023.10219099","url":null,"abstract":"This paper proposes an ultrasonic system based on an innovative piezoelectric device, the Frequency Steerable Acoustic Transducer (FSAT). The FSAT’s high directivity can be exploited for structural inspection, and through-metal data communication and wireless power transfer. These three functions are fundamental in an autonomous sensor system developed for condition monitoring, which is a central requirement in many sectors, such as automotive. A novel pulser, made up of a signal generator and a power amplifier, has been designed and simulated, for effectively driving the FSAT transducer. Experimental results showed that the designed power amplifier is able to reach a gain of 17.80 dB driving the piezoelectric transducer with a maximum peak-to-peak voltage of 24 V and that its bandwidth is [3.1-964] kHz. Laracca","doi":"10.1109/MetroAutomotive57488.2023.10219104","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/MetroAutomotive57488.2023.10219104","url":null,"abstract":"In this paper, a novel approach based on a Genetic Programming (GP) algorithm is proposed to develop behavioral models for Lithium batteries. In particular, this approach is herein adopted to analytically correlate the battery terminal voltage to its State of Charge (SoC) and Charge rate (C-rate) for discharging current profiles. The GP discovers the best possible analytical models, from which the optimal one is selected by weighing several criteria and enforcing a trade-off between the accuracy and the simplicity of the obtained mathematical function. The proposed models can be considered an extension of the behavioral models that are already in use, such as those based on equivalent electrical circuits. This GP approach can overcome some current limitations, such as the high time required to perform experimental tests to estimate the parameters of an equivalent electrical model (particularly effective since it must be repeated with the battery aging) and the need for some a-priory knowledge for the model estimation. In this paper, a Lithium Titanate Oxide battery has been considered as a case study, analyzing its behavior for SoC comprised between 5% and 95% and C-rate between 0.25C and 4.0C. Sandrolini","doi":"10.1109/MetroAutomotive57488.2023.10219093","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/MetroAutomotive57488.2023.10219093","url":null,"abstract":"The growing diffusion of off-board battery chargers for electric vehicles leads to a severe increase in electromagnetic interference (EMI) in power grids, and in particular of conducted disturbances. The battery chargers must therefore be equipped with suitable power line filters to reduce conducted emission (CE). In order to efficiently design the three-phase filter, the modal decomposition of the disturbance is exploited. In three-phase systems both the differential mode (DM) and common mode (CM) components of the specific phase disturbances generally contribute differently to the overall CE. This paper shows a simple methodology for the design of a three-phase EMI filter using a setup capable of simultaneously measuring the conducted disturbances on each phase and directly calculating the modal components.
